Officer discovered dead by hanging.
An ASI from Tentulikhunti police station in Nabarangpur was found dead at a tourist spot, after being missing for several days.
An ASI from Tentulikhunti police station in Nabarangpur was found dead at a tourist spot, after being missing for several days.